The way mine works is, if you have the fog light switch on, they should come on with the first notch of the main light switch along with the parking lights. The headlights should stay down. Pull all the way and all should come on if your fog light switch is on. But to get the headlights to stay up and the lights to go out (if you want to wash the headlights, for instance) you have to go from the full out position on the switch and push it back in one notch.
